The Takeaway: Google's heavy investment in world models through Gemini represents a distinct bet on grounding AI in rich multimodal understanding of the physical world rather than pure language or code self-improvement loops. Oriol Vinyals, co-lead of Gemini at Google DeepMind with a storied career in deep learning breakthroughs, emphasizes that while language has provided massive knowledge distillation, video and image data hold untapped potential for deeper physics and causal understanding. Progress in models like Omni shows impressive interactive video generation and editing, yet the 'GPT moment' for pure visual transfer learning remains ahead. Vinyals notes the challenges in representation learning and connecting concepts without explicit language labels. On agents, he highlights improvements in scaffolding, long-running reliability, and memory systems using file-based nonparametric storage for continual learning. He remains optimistic about AGI timelines, viewing current models as approaching it under certain definitions while stressing the need for better experiential learning.
